Spirit Halloween will open a Bethesda location for the 2020 Halloween season. It will be located in the former Sears space at Westfield Montgomery Mall. You may recall last year a lesser-known Halloween props-and-costumes retailer used the Sears space. This year, we're getting the real thing. A visit to Spirit Halloween is a Halloween-season event in itself!
Residents in the North Bethesda/White Flint area will be glad to know that Spirit Halloween will also have a second store in their area. It will be at Federal Plaza in the former Five Below space, and will open on September 8. No opening date has been announced for the Bethesda store yet.

Halloween City opens at Montgomery Mall (Video+Photos)
Halloween City has just opened in the top floor of the shuttered Sears store at Westfield Montgomery Mall. They are so new that they are still stocking the shelves, as you can tell from the photos below. Halloween City offers costumes, accessories, props and decorations. They're only using part of the sales floor, but if you miss Sears, this is your chance to get back inside one more time before it's demolished.

Bradley Party & Variety is fully stocked for Halloween (Photos)
Now the only variety store left in Bethesda, Bradley Party & Variety is going all-out for the Halloween season, aiming to be the headquarters for costumes, decorations, accessories, party goods and more. Stop by between 3:00 and 7:00 PM daily to see the gargoyle in the front window put on a scary performance complete with sound and billowing smoke. Want to buy it for yourself? That will set you back $3999 for this movie-quality prop.

Costumes range from Zoolander to Superman to a high-tech Godzilla get-up that's probably going to be more realistic and entertaining than the Matthew Broderick version. Every type of ghoul imaginable to haunt your home or haunted house is here, along with an army's worth of party supplies, dinnerware, welcome mats, and scary invitations.
With no pop-up mega-Halloween stores in downtown Bethesda, Bradley Party & Variety is going to come in handy for the serious Halloween fanatic and last-minute costume shopper alike. Bradley Party & Variety is located in the Bradley Shopping Center at 6922 Arlington Road.
